U of G launches free farm business management course

Free farm business management skills training, ranging from farm business planning to maintaining mental health, will be offered through a new, self-paced, virtual course being launched in January.


New governmental committee to assist affected P.E.I. potato farmers

The committee will be an important forum to exchange information and further develop strategies to address the issue, while minimizing impacts of potato wart on the P.E.I. potato sector.


GoodLeaf Farms builds vertical farm project in Calgary

The new farm will create about 70 skilled and unskilled job opportunities in the city and will serve as a focal point for partnerships with post-secondary schools in Canada’s west.

GHC: Local farming project soars in First Nation community

It’s been about two years since Virginia Muswagon and Ian Maxwell started growing fresh produce for Norway House Cree Nation using a hydroponic container garden. Together they are co-managers of Life Water Gardens (Pimâtisiwin Nipî Kistikânihk) and they seed, harvest, and deliver fresh produce to their local community weekly. » Read more...
